My Father La Promesa Corona Gorda (5.5″ x 48) refers to José “Pepín” García’s promise made when he left Cuba for the United States in 2001 to prove himself in the cigar industry and bring pride to his family’s name. This handmade cigar features an Ecuadorian Habano Rosado wrapper with binder and fillers grown on the García family farms in Nicaragua. It comes in a stick package and is not box pressed and not flavored. The cigar measures 5.50 inches in length with a 48 ring gauge and is produced in Nicaragua.
